Вопросы с тегом «migration»

Действие перехода между основными версиями любого фреймворка, продукта или языка или, как обычно, изменение схемы данных приложения. Это может включать изменение существующих данных, чтобы они работали с новой версией.

9
Как перейти / конвертировать из SVN в Mercurial (hg) в windows
Я ищу инструмент для переноса пары репозиториев SVN на Mercurial с историей, метками и т. Д. Я использую TortoiseHg (Windows x32), поэтому ConvertExtensions отбрасываются. Есть некоторая информация о том, как сделать этот процесс на Linux- машине ( hgsvn ), но у меня нет Linux-машины. Могу ли я использовать эти сценарии …

4
Rails has_and_belongs_to_many миграция
У меня есть две модели, restaurantи userя хочу установить связь has_and_belongs_to_many. Я уже вошел в файлы модели и добавил has_and_belongs_to_many :restaurantsиhas_and_belongs_to_many :users Я предполагаю, что на этом этапе я смогу сделать что-то вроде Rails 3: rails generate migration .... но все, что я пробовал, похоже, терпит неудачу. Я уверен, что …

5
Rails: добавление индекса после добавления столбца
Предположим, я создал таблицу tableв приложении Rails. Некоторое время спустя добавляю столбец, работающий: rails generate migration AddUser_idColumnToTable user_id:string. Затем я понимаю, что мне нужно добавить user_idв качестве индекса. Я знаю о add_indexметоде, но где его вызывать? Должен ли я выполнить миграцию (если да, какую?), А затем добавить вручную этот метод?


7
Заполнение базы данных в файле миграции Laravel
Я только изучаю Laravel, и у меня есть рабочий файл миграции, создающий таблицу пользователей. Я пытаюсь заполнить запись пользователя в рамках миграции: public function up() { Schema::create('users', function($table){ $table->increments('id'); $table->string('email', 255); $table->string('password', 64); $table->boolean('verified'); $table->string('token', 255); $table->timestamps(); DB::table('users')->insert( array( 'email' => 'name@domain.com', 'verified' => true ) ); }); } Но …

11
Хотите обновить проект с Angular v5 до Angular v6
Поскольку Angular 6 здесь, я хочу обновить или переместить мое клиентское приложение angular 5 на angular 6, но я не получаю никакого руководства или чего-либо, что могло бы помочь мне. По моему мнению, мне просто нужно запустить новый Angular CLI, а затем переместить мой старый исходный код в новый проект. …

5
Назначение значения по умолчанию при создании файла миграции
rails generate migration AddRetweetsCountToTweet retweets_count:integer Хорошо, я использую строку выше для создания файла миграции, который автоматически генерирует код в сгенерированном файле, чтобы добавить столбец в твит модели с целым числом типа данных. Теперь я хочу добавить значение по умолчанию в добавленный столбец при создании файла миграции. Это возможно? Я погуглил, …

7
Преобразование файла дампа SQLITE SQL в POSTGRESQL
Я занимаюсь разработкой с использованием базы данных SQLITE с производством в POSTGRESQL. Я только что обновил свою локальную базу данных огромным количеством данных, и мне нужно передать определенную таблицу в производственную базу данных. При запуске sqlite database .dump > /the/path/to/sqlite-dumpfile.sqlSQLITE выводит дамп таблицы в следующем формате: BEGIN TRANSACTION; CREATE TABLE …

7
Загрузка исходных данных с помощью Django 1.7 и миграции данных
Недавно я перешел с Django 1.6 на 1.7 и начал использовать миграции (я никогда не использовал South). До версии 1.7 я загружал исходные данные fixture/initial_data.jsonфайлом, который загружался python manage.py syncdbкомандой (при создании базы данных). Теперь я начал использовать миграции, и такое поведение устарело: Если приложение использует миграции, автоматическая загрузка фикстур …

9
Ruby on Rails: как я могу отменить миграцию с помощью rake db: migrate?
После установки devise MODEL User я получил это. class DeviseCreateUsers < ActiveRecord::Migration def self.up create_table(:users) do |t| t.database_authenticatable :null => false t.recoverable t.rememberable t.trackable # t.encryptable # t.confirmable # t.lockable :lock_strategy => :failed_attempts, :unlock_strategy => :both # t.token_authenticatable t.timestamps end add_index :users, :email, :unique => true add_index :users, :reset_password_token, :unique …



21
Миграция конкретной таблицы Laravel 5.4
Привет, прочтите всю включенную документацию здесь, в https://laravel.com/docs/5.4/migrations . Есть ли способ перенести определенный файл миграции (только 1 миграция), потому что прямо сейчас каждый раз, когда есть изменение, которое я использую, php artisan migrate:refreshи все поля сбрасываются.

6
Как я могу переименовать столбец в laravel с помощью миграции?
У меня есть столбцы, как указано ниже: public function up() { Schema::create('stnk', function(Blueprint $table) { $table->increments('id'); $table->string('no_reg', 50)->unique(); $table->string('no_bpkb', 50)->unique(); $table->string('nama_pemilik', 100); $table->string('alamat'); $table->string('merk', 50); $table->string('tipe', 50); $table->string('jenis', 50); $table->smallInteger('tahun_pembuatan'); $table->smallInteger('tahun_registrasi'); $table->smallInteger('isi_silinder'); $table->string('no_rangka', 50); $table->string('no_mesin', 50); $table->string('warna', 50); $table->string('bahan_bakar', 50); $table->string('warna_tnkb', 50); $table->string('kode_lokasi', 50); $table->date('berlaku_sampai'); $table->timestamps(); $table->index('created_at'); $table->index('updated_at'); }); } …

14
Не удалось загрузить файл или сборку Microsoft.Build.Framework (VS 2017)
Когда я пытаюсь запустить команду «update-database», я получаю следующее исключение: Укажите флаг «-Verbose» для просмотра операторов SQL, применяемых к целевой базе данных. System.IO.FileNotFoundException: не удалось загрузить файл или сборку Microsoft.Build.Framework, Version = 15.1.0.0, Culture = нейтральный, PublicKeyToken = b03f5f7f11d50a3a или одну из его зависимостей. Система не может найти указанный файл. …

Используя наш сайт, вы подтверждаете, что прочитали и поняли нашу Политику в отношении файлов cookie и Политику конфиденциальности.
Licensed under cc by-sa 3.0 with attribution required.